Mighty Chocolate Milk by Nurished is a clean-label kids' protein powder featuring 8g of whey protein, 2 billion probiotics, and organic spinach per serving. Free from artificial colors, flavors, and sweeteners, it supports healthy development and digestion in toddlers and young children with 15-30 servings per pouch. Amazing chocolate milk alternative!
Absolutely love this for my almost 2 year old! We wanted a healthier swap from Nesquick and I’m so happy we found this. Only took about a day for my daughter to get used to the different taste but now she loves it! I will say it’s a little on the sweet side so I do 8 ounces of milk to one scoop. Getting it to dissolve is a little difficult too, but that’s easily resolved with using a handheld milk frother to mix it. It smells and tastes great. (Just have to get used to it if you or your child has been drinking unhealthy chocolate milks for a while) Love all the vitamins and nutrients included and that it’s made clean. Because of the price I definitely did my research before purchasing but now I can say it’s definitely worth it.

Best for picky toddler!
My 1 year old gagged every time we had her try whole milk when switching from formula. Tried blending in strawberries, oat milk, goat milk, half formula/whole milk, and this mighty milk is literally the only thing she loves and will actually drink whole milk now. Would recommend for anyone struggling with their baby transitioning to whole milk.
